Ente Auth Alternatives

Ente Auth is described as 'Generates, stores, and encrypts two-factor authentication tokens, enables secure backup, offers offline access, multi-device sync, and flexible import/export options' and is a very popular Authenticator in the security & privacy category. There are more than 25 alternatives to Ente Auth for a variety of platforms, including iPhone, Android, iPad, Android Tablet and Mac apps. The best Ente Auth alternative is Aegis Authenticator, which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like Ente Auth are Proton Authenticator, Bitwarden Authenticator, Authy and 2FA Authenticator (2FAS).
